** Controlled Flow Nozzle for Metal Salt Deposition **The Controlled Flow Nozzle for Metal Salt Deposition is designed for precision application of metal salts. It features an airbrush-like elongated shape that allows for controlled and even deposition. The substantial 250 ml solution tank ensures extended operation without frequent refills, making it ideal for various metal deposition processes.
* 1.Assemblies and Sub-assemblies: *1.1 Solution Tank Assembly: description: 'A 250 ml tank made from high-grade transparent material for visibility of contents; sealed with a leak-proof cap.' dimensions: length: 200 mm diameter: 70 mm weight: 150 g1.2 Nozzle Assembly: description: 'Tapered nozzle for precise deposition; features an adjustable aperture for varying flow control.' dimensions: length: 50 mm diameter: 5 mm at tip weight: 30 g1.3 Grip Assembly: description: 'Ergonomic grip designed for user comfort; constructed with non-slip materials.' dimensions: length: 120 mm width: 25 mm height: 30 mm weight: 100 g1.4 Gas Inlet Assembly: description: 'Accepts input from a 1 bar compressor; features a quick-connect mechanism.' dimensions: diameter: 10 mm weight: 20 g1.5 Internal Channel Design: description: 'Smooth internal channels promote optimal flow of solution and gas minimizing clogging.' dimensions: channel_diameter: 3 mm weight: <1 g
* 2.Materials and Standards: *2.1 Solution Tank: material: 'Polycarbonate or glass for chemical resistance and visibility.' standards: 'Food grade to ensure safe handling of materials.'2.2 Nozzle: material: 'High-grade stainless steel or brass for durability and corrosion resistance.'2.3 Grip: material: 'Thermoplastic elastomer for comfort and grip.'2.4 Gas Inlet: material: 'Brass or aluminum for strength and corrosion resistance.'2.5 Manufacturing Standards: standards: 'ISO 9001 certified manufacturing processes for high quality and performance.'
